What made you want to go into your field?
I have always wanted to be a small business owner and be my own boss. I learned at an early age that I didn't like receiving orders. I chose the moving industry because I felt that I could fill a void in Santa Barbara, that is giving the customer a friendly, timely, and professional move for an affordable rate.
What do you like most about your job?
I enjoy being part of every customers experience with moving into a new place or buying that first house, getting that dream apartment or moving into that office with a great view. It is exciting for me to share the joy of moving with every client. I also like to be able to structure my own schedule which gives me free time to enjoy all that the beautiful town of Santa Barbara has to offer.
What challenges do you face on a daily basis?
I face many different challenges everyday. One phone call can change my whole day, week, or even month. I recieve many calls from customers in binds who need help immediately, and as you know, that can be a very difficult task. My company is small. We have 4 full time employees and three part time employees, which makes our schedules a bit hectic at times. In Santa Barbara, there are around 30 different moving companies so coming up with marketing ideas and what seprates my company can be a struggle.
What characteristics does someone need to be a successful in your field?
A small business owner has to be many things to be successful. I believe that first and foremost you must be professional. The clientle in Santa Barabara are all educated and demanding people of the service industry. You must also be a very organized and on time person who can multi task at the sound of a phone call. The moving business is very competetive so you must stay persistent at all times, because there are many other companies that are ready to help your clients.
